About Chilton County, Alabama

Chilton County in Alabama has a median household income of $62,471 and a median home value of $136,000. These local economics significantly impact divorce settlement calculations, including asset division, spousal maintenance, and post-divorce housing affordability.

These estimates use county-level medians. Actual settlement costs depend on the complexity of your case, attorney fees, asset mix, and whether the divorce is contested. Use our calculator for a detailed, personalized analysis.
